Miami Heat have won one Championship and five Division titles in their history. Established an expansion team in 1987, the Heat have gradually built up their determination and play to culminate in their recent Championship win in the 2005-06 season. The Heat play in the Southeast Division of the Eastern Conference, and are located in Miami, Florida.
Miami Heat have moved arenas only once in their history, changing from the Miami Arena to the new AmericanAirlines Arena in 1999. In their new arena, the Heat enjoy facilities including seating for up to 20,000 fans, dining and premium suites. It was also one of the venues for their 2005-06 Championship title.
Due to their relatively young age, Miami Heat have yet to see any players or coaches promoted to the Basketball Hall of Fame. If they continue their past successes, however, many such appointments may be on the cards for future years.
